 Vegetable Math Focus/Overview Students will measure various items in the garden to complete math problems in an outdoor environment. Learning Objective(s) Grade Level The learner will: 4 • Measure items in the garden to determine differing Duration: measurements such as shape, perimeter and area 1 hour • Identify different types of angles • Identify shapes Setting: • Determine measurements as a percent In the model school garden Louisiana GLE’s/ CCSS Vocabulary: M.4.22 Select and use the appropriate standard units of Obtuse, right, acute, measure, abbreviations, and tools to measure length and circumference, radius, perimeter (i.e., in., cm ,ft., yd., mile, m, km), area (i.e., diameter, shape, area, square inch, square foot, square centimeter), capacity percent (i.e., fl. oz., cup, pt., qt., gal., l, ml), weight/mass (i.e., oz., lb., g, kg, ton), and volume (i.e., cubic cm, cubic in.) 4.MD.1, 4.MD.3 M.4.25 Use estimates and measurements to calculate perimeter and area of rectangular objects (including square feet) in U.S. and metric units. 4.MD.3 M.4.32 Draw, identify, and classify angles that are acute, right, and obtuse 4.G.1 Materials: • Math worksheet • Pencil • Tape measure Background Information: Circumference is the distance around a circle. The area of a triangle can be determined by measuring both the base and the height of the triangle and using the following formula ½ base * height = area. Procedure: 1. Twenty backpacks are available for use. If you have 20 or less students they will each have a back pack and can be further divided into groups of 5. If you have 40 students simply break the groups into 10 students each with 5 backpacks per group. Students within the group should have matching backpacks. There are four sets of backpacks, tomatoes, corn, peppers, and carrots. 2. Tell the students to use the tape measures in the backpacks and their team members to answer the questions on the worksheet. 3. Have students work in teams to complete the vegetable math worksheet. Allow them at least 40 minutes in the garden to determine the answers. 4. As a group discuss student answers. Student Name ______________________________________________________
